What changed

The two rankings measure different things on different scopes. The visibility ranking summarises published third-party AI-visibility assessments of luxury destinations across the summer. The visit ranking counts distinct identified yachts of 24 metres and over per fenced destination between 15 June and 29 July: Monaco 419, Saint-Tropez 352, Porto Cervo 316, Cannes 308, Antibes 278.

Observation period
15 June – 29 July 2026 for recorded visits; summer 2026 for the published rankings
Publication date
July 2026
Measure
Distinct identified yachts 24 m and over per fenced destination, versus third-party published rankings on their own stated scopes
Coverage & limits
The two rankings are separately scoped and dated; neither implies causation. Fence boundaries differ by destination and are stated with each count.
